Where America Survived

Morristown National Historical Park commemorates the sites of General Washington and the Continental army's winter encampment of December 1779 to June 1780, where they survived through what would be the coldest winter on record. - NPS

1777/02/00 Continental Army George Washington orders smallpox inoculations for all Continental Army troops in Morristown.
1777/02/00 Dr Jabez Campfield American Surgeon George Washington orders smallpox inoculations for all Continental Army troops in Morristown.
1777/02/06 George Washington American Commander in Chief Finding the Small pox to be spreading much and fearing that no precaution can prevent it from running through the whole of our Army, I have determined that the troops shall be inoculated. - Washington letter to Dr William Shippen Smallpox Vaccine
1779/12/09 Maj Gen Nathanael Greene American Commander With the British in New York, GW is "obligd to canton the American Army in on both sides of the North River, and the diminution of our strength from the expiring enlistments obligd the General to take an interior position for the greater security...." NG
1780/01/29 Nathaniel Ray Greene Born Catharine Littlefield Greene, wife of Nathanael Greene, give birth to a son, Nathaniel Ray Greene, at the Winter Quarters of the American Army at Morristown, New Jersey.
